Output dd374c680302ab9608fe36e68c1a55c26435e692ca48216864e48aa14261502e:0

value
129748220
script pubkey
OP_0 OP_PUSHBYTES_20 68f9829f7f64617571f2d87128712ff99e7d1b62
address
bc1qdruc98mlv3sh2u0jmpcjsuf0lx086xmzkhwvht
transaction
dd374c680302ab9608fe36e68c1a55c26435e692ca48216864e48aa14261502e
spent
true